Oat Field

Art Appreciation

In this stunning depiction of a tranquil countryside scene, soft hues cascade across the canvas, inviting the viewer to lose themselves in the expansive oat field. The delicate play of light captures the essence of a gentle breeze that rustles through the tall grasses, embellished with subtle pops of color from wildflowers that dot the landscape. The composition is particularly engaging; it draws the eye from the foreground, where the textures of the field come alive, to the serene clusters of trees in the background that stand sentinel against the pastel sky, awash in light. Here, the artist's deft brushwork smooths the distance, creating a harmonious balance between land and sky, evoking a sense of peace and calm.

The color palette, characterized by soft greens, pale yellows, and hints of muted blues, enhances the overall emotional impact, suggesting a fleeting moment of beauty and tranquility. Each stroke seems to breathe life into the scene, creating an ethereal quality that lingers in one's thoughts. Historically, this artwork is emblematic of the Impressionist movement, capturing not just a physical landscape, but also an ephemeral experience of nature. Monet's approach indicates a deep appreciation for the nuances of light and color, and invites the viewer to experience the beauty of the natural world in an intimate way, challenging conventional perspectives on beauty and representation in art.
